A fantastic boutique hotel! The location is very good, at the old town of Bangkok. Unlike the Sukhumvit side, this part of Bangkok, on the opposite of the river, where the palaces, main temples, government ministries are, is clean and calm. The particular neighbourhood of 1905 Heritage Corner is a beautiful "experimental" housing community from one of the prince of a distant past. The hotel is surrounded with great food - lots of small eateries and the best beef noodle and home made ice cream you can find. There are no big international hotels in this area - 1905 is small but the service will beat even Mandarin Oriental in Bangkok. The restoration, the details and the quality of finishing by Mark and Nan is phenomenon - again, the best I have seen in Thailand or anywhere in the world.
